The area of a right-angled triangle is 30 cm2 and the sum of the legs is 17 cm, find the hypotenuse of the triangle.

1. Vertices of the triangle – А, В, С. А = 90 °.

2. We take the length of the leg AB for x, the length of the leg AC for y.

3. Let’s compose two equations:

x x y / 2 = 30; x x y = 60; x = 60 / y:

x + y = 17;

4. Substitute x = 60 / y into the second equation:

60 / y + y = 17;

y² – 17y + 60 = 0.

The equation has two roots.

The first value of y = (17 + √289 – 240) / 2 = (17 + 7) / 2 = 12;

The second value is y = (17 – 7) / 2 = 5.

Each of the legs has two meanings:

AB = 12 cm and 5 cm.

AC = 5 cm and 12 cm.

5. Hypotenuse BC = √144 + 25 = 13 cm.
